hey guys wondering if I can buy steelies and also buy 225 55 17 or 215 55 17 snow tires and didnt know if they will fit on my 2011? or do they need to be wider tires?
also is it possible to go down to say a 225 55 16 in rim and will the brakes clear?
thanks for the help!
Geever, I bought a set of 16" steel wheels for my 2013 WRX from the TireRack and mounted 215x55x16 snows on them... works great.
Saves the original wheels from the Vermont salt! Those summer meats are worthless in the snow.
16 inch '02-'07 wheels will fit a 2011 wrx.
